Job Description Summary

Small Business Navigator will provide strategic guidance and support to local startups. This role is pivotal in fostering a thriving business community by offering in-depth consulting and facilitating growth and development opportunities within assigned counties. (Delta, Alger, and Schoolcraft Counties)

Essential Duties & Responsibilities (other duties may be assigned)

  1. Consulting and Coaching Duties
    * Actively guide and encourage clients through targeted questioning and reflection, to improve their leadership, decision-making and business acumen.
    * Provide one-on-one consultations to entrepreneurs and small business owners, focusing on developing business plans, strategies, marketing, product/service delivery, and financial planning.
    * Offer advice and resources for navigating legal and regulatory requirements for small businesses.
    * Build meaningful connections with stakeholders through timely, transparent and effective communication.
  2. Navigator Specific Duties:
    * Be available to small businesses in their assigned territory a minimum of 36 hours a week (unless on PTO)
    * Travel directly to small businesses in their area on a regular (at least quarterly) basis
    * Proactively build relationships with businesses and economic development organizations in their territory
    * Continually learn and engage in professional development opportunities to better perform their role
    * Host trainings, networking, and other events as determined to be most impactful in each county (minimum of one per calendar quarter)*
    * Meet county-level targets established by the Hub, including reporting to a centralized system
    * Recommend actions for marketing the Hub in assigned counties.
    * Attend Hub Advisory Council meetings as asked by HUB Coordinator
    * Assist the Hub Coordinator with small business grants in their coverage area
    * Work directly with an assigned intern from the NMU Main Street Academy
  3. Administrative Duties:
    * Track all business engagements and interactions in Salesforce CRM.
    * Document and monitor client progress, ensuring accountability and measuring intervention effectiveness.
  4. Commit to learning about continuous improvement strategies and applying them to everyday work. Actively engage in University continuous improvement initiatives.
  5. Apply safety-related knowledge, skills, and practices to everyday work.
